The Buffalo Philharmonic Orchestra brings its exceptional talent to Clarence Town Park for a special outdoor concert. This community event offers a unique opportunity to enjoy world-class symphonic music in a relaxed, scenic environment. Featuring a curated program of classical masterpieces, the performance is designed to delight music lovers of all ages. Bring a blanket or chair and join your neighbors for an unforgettable evening of culture and harmony under the summer sky.

Frequently Asked Questions
Where is the concert held?
It is held at Clarence Town Park, 10405 Main St, Clarence, NY.
Is there an admission fee?
These community concerts are typically free to the public.
What should I bring?
Bring a lawn chair or blanket for comfortable seating on the grass.
Is it family-friendly?
Yes, the concert is open to all ages and is a great family outing.
What if it rains?
Check the BPO or town website for weather-related updates or rain dates.
How long is the concert?
The performance typically lasts for about 90 minutes to two hours.
